ABSTRACT
Chaos theory offers a new way to investigate variations in financial markets data that cannot be obtained with traditional methods. The primary approach for diagnosing chaos is the existence of positive small Lyapunov views. The positive Lyapunov index indicates the average instability and the system's chaotic nature. The negativity indicates the average rate of non-chaoticness. In this paper, a new approach on basis of type-3 fuzzy logic systems is introduced for modeling the chaotic dynamics of financial data. Also, the attracting dimension tests and the Lyapunov views in the reconstructed dynamics are used for examinations. The simulations on case-study currency market show the applicability and good accuracy of the suggested approach.
